OrchView / OrchPlay - Developments and Progress Report / Développements et aperçu des progrès

OrchView / OrchPlay - Developments and Progress ReporOn July 15, Félix Baril (DMus, Composition, McGill University) and Baptiste Bohelay (MSc, Computer Science, IRCAM) presented their progress on the programming, design and development of the OrchView software in the context of the ACTOR year 1 Workshop in Paris.

This presentation was followed by a demonstration of score annotations in OrchView, simplified thanks to the implementation of a custom MusicXML score package developed by ACTOR student members Philippe Macnab-Séguin, Dominique Lafortune, and Aurélien Antoine. The data format in which these annotations are encoded was also explained and discussed.  Prof. Dr. Aristotelis Hadjakos (Detmold University of Music) suggested some improvements to the data structure which were implemented in the following weeks. With these improvements the OrchView annotation data are now entirely independent of the musical score and intelligible on their own. This will allow for more flexibility in graphical score representation as well as simplifying the exchange of research data with collaborators and the transfer of data between applications.

 The Perceptual Grouping Effects tools for OrchView are currently being updated to reflect the recent changes in the data model based on work by Stephen McAdams, Meghan Goodchild and Kit Soden. Bea Lopez (BSc, Computer Science, McGill University) will be updating the new data model for the Orchard database in parallel to the work being done in OrchView.

A significantly improved metadata format for orchestral score annotations was finalized during the summer. It contains specific searchable items such as the musical form, the musical period, the lyricist, the language, the orchestrator, etc.

Félix Baril  also presented an updated version of OrchPlay from institutional partner OrchPlayMusic, Inc. He  demonstrated how instruments and bars annotated in OrchView can immediately be heard in OrchPlay —isolated from the rest of the orchestra —and how OrchPlay scores may be opened in OrchView to be annotated.

This was followed by a preview of the OrchPlay mixer modified to support the importing of multitrack recordings from the ODESSA project. ODESSA files imported into OrchPlay support an unlimited number of audio mixes that can be saved as bookmarks and shared with other OrchPlay users from the ACTOR project. The OrchPlay demonstration ended with a discussion of the possibility of importing multitrack audio of electroacoustic music to take advantage of OrchPlay’s stage view, mixer, and bookmark functions.

OrchPlay currently offers more than 125 musical excerpts. A complete version of Tristan’s Prelude by Wagner rendered by Félix Baril will be released this fall. Gabriel Dufour-Laperrière, Dominique Lafortune, and Philippe Macnab-Séguin are also entering and rendering new musical excerpts as well as converting the entire OrchPlayMusic library to MusicXML.

Finally, a new, more efficient protocol that will accelerate the note-entry process has been developed. It will simplify the training of new note-entry recruits and allow for the exportation of scores to a musicXML format compatible with OrchView and data-mining purposes.

——

OrchView / OrchPlay - Développements et aperçu des progrès

Le 15 juillet dernier, Félix Baril (DMus, composition, Université McGill) et Baptiste Bohelay (MSc en informatique, Ircam) ont présenté l’avancement de leurs travaux de programmation, de design et de développement du logiciel OrchView dans le cadre de la rencontre annuelle ACTOR (ACTOR year 1Workshop) à Paris.

La présentation a été suivie d’une démonstration d’annotations de partitions dans OrchView, simplifiée grâce à l’implémentation d’un package custom en MusicXML développé par les membres étudiants d’ACTOR Philippe Macnab-Séguin, Dominique Lafortune et par le stagiaire postdoctoral Aurélien Antoine. Le format des données dans lequel les annotations ont été encodées a également été expliqué et a fait l’objet d’une discussion. Le professeur Dr. Aristotelis Hadjakos (Hochschule für Musik Detmold) a suggéré quelques pistes d’amélioration à la structure de données qui sera implémentée dans les prochaines semaines. Grâce à ces améliorations, les données d’annotations dans OrchView seront complètement indépendantes de la partition musicale, ainsi qu’intelligibles par elles-mêmes. Ceci permettra plus de flexibilité dans la représentation graphique des partitions tout en simplifiant l’échange de données de recherche entre collaborateurs, ainsi que le transfert de données entre applications.

La mise à jour de l’outil “Perceptual Grouping Effects” pour OrchView est présentement en cours, de manière à refléter les changements récents dans le modèle de données basé sur les travaux de Stephen McAdams, Meghan Goodchild et Kit Soden. Bea Lopez (BSc en informatique, Université McGill) ajustera le modèle structurant la base de données Orchard en conséquence, parallèlement au travail effectué sur OrchView.

L’amélioration significative d’un format de métadonnées pour les annotations de partitions orchestrales a été finalisé cet été. Il contient des items spécifiques pour la recherche de données tels que la forme musicale, la période de composition, le librettiste, la langue, l’orchestrateur, etc.

Une version mise à jour d’OrchPlay du partenaire institutionnel OrchPlayMusic Inc. a également été présenté. On a démontré comment les annotations d’instruments et de mesures dans OrchView peuvent immédiatement être entendues dans OrchPlay isolées du reste de l’orchestre, et comment les partitions dans OrchPlay peuvent être ouvertes dans OrchView pour être annotées.

Ceci a été suivi par un aperçu d’une modification dans le mixer OrchPlay permettant d’importer des enregistrements multipistes réalisés dans le cadre du projet ODESSA. Les fichiers ODESSA importés dans OrchPlay supportent un nombre illimité de mixes audio qui peuvent être sauvegardés dans un dossier de favoris et partagés avec d’autres utilisateurs d’OrchPlay faisant partie du projet ACTOR. La démonstration d’OrchPlay s’est terminée avec une discussion sur la possibilité d’importer des enregistrements multipistes de musique électroacoustique, de manière à tirer avantage des fonctions OrchPlay pour la visualisation scénique, le mix et la sauvegarde de favoris. 

Présentement, OrchPlay offre plus de 125 extraits musicaux. Une version complète du Prélude de Tristan und Isolde de Wagner, réalisée par Félix Baril, sera lancée cet automne. Gabriel Dufour-Laperrière, Dominique Lafortune et Philippe Macnab-Séguin participent également aux entrées et rendus de nouveaux extraits musicaux, tout en travaillant à la conversion de la totalité de la librairie OrchPlayMusic vers le format MusicXML.

Finalement, un nouveau protocole plus performant, permettant d’accélérer le processus d’entrée de notes, a été développé. Il simplifiera le processus de formation des nouvelles recrues travaillant à l’entrée de notes et permettra l’exportation des partitions dans un format MusicXML compatible avec OrchView ainsi que plusieurs démarches d’exploration de données (data-mining).

Previous
Previous

Aural Sonology taxonomic leg / Branche consacrée à la Aural Sonology

Next
Next

A musicXML protocol / Un protocole MusicXML